Rest and adequate hydration are essential for recovery. Patients should complete the full antibiotic course even if symptoms improve early. Supplemental oxygen may be needed for low blood oxygen levels. Over-the-counter medications can relieve fever and discomfort. Follow-up chest X-rays help confirm full recovery. Vaccination against pneumococcal bacteria and influenza remains the best preventive strategy for high-risk individuals.
